#647b26 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#647b26 is composed of 39.2% red, 48.2%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.1%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 76.2 degrees, a saturation of 52.8% and a lightness of 31.6%. #647b26 color hex could be obtained by blending #c8f64c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#647b26
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030301 is the darkest color, while #f9fbf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#647b26
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#53564b is the less saturated color, while #75a001 is the most saturated one.
